Three vertices of parallelogram JKLM are J(1, 4), K(5, 3), and L(6,−3). Find the coordinates of vertex M.
Andrej [43]

Answer:

coordinates of vertex M is (x, y) = (2, -2)

Step-by-step explanation:

Since JKLM is a  parallelogram, this implies that JK parallel to LM and KL parallel to JM. This means that

Slope of JK = slope of LM

\frac{3-4}{5-1} =\frac{-3-y}{6-x} \\y=-\frac{1}{4}x-\frac{3}{2} ....(i)

And

Slope of KL = slope of JM

\frac{3-\left(-3\right)}{5-6}=\frac{4-y}{1-x}\\y=10-6x...(ii)

From equation (i) and (ii) we get

-\frac{1}{4}x-\frac{3}{2} =10-6x

-\frac{23x}{4}=-\frac{23}{2}

-23x=-46

x=2

Put the value of x in equation (ii) we get

y=10-6(2)\\y=-2

So, the coordinates of vertex M is (x, y) = (2, -2).
